Collaborative Planning,Forecasting,and Replenishment (CPFR) is a web-based tool used to coordinate demand forecasting,production and purchase planning,and inventory replenishment between supply chain trading partners.In practice CPFR often doesn't deliver on its' promise because;
1) Computer systems at supplier companies cannot be made to work with each other.
2) Forecast errors accumulate as data exchanges are made down the supply chain culminating in the "feast or famine" phenomena known as the "bullwhip effect."
3) Firms in a supply chain may not trust each other sufficiently to share information openly.
4) conflicting objectives between the profit-maximizing vendor and the cost-minimizing customer give rise to adversarial supply chain relationships
